Ouahigouya: The governor of the Yaadga region, Thomas Yampa, officially launched the 6th edition of the Sports Training Schools (EFORS) competitions on Monday in the city of Naaba Kango during a solemn flag-raising ceremony.
According to Burkina Information Agency, the ceremony took place at the regional sports directorate in July 2025. It was attended by administrative officials, defense and security forces, and local residents, who joined together to sing the Ditany¨ in French. This month's event was distinguished by the commencement of the 6th edition of the Inter-Schools competitions, organized by the Ministry of Sports, Youth and Employment (MSJE) through the Permanent Secretariat for Young Sportspeople.
The Secretary General of the MSJE, Colette Ou©draogo, expressed gratitude on behalf of the Minister of Sports to the regional bodies for their dedication and support for the event. She emphasized that the activity is integral to the sports development project and aims to promote youth sports in Burkina Faso.
Governor Thomas Yampa encouraged the local population to actively participate in the competitions and wished all participants a successful and fair contest. From July 7 to 12, young athletes will compete in various sports, including football, volleyball, handball, cycling, wrestling, and athletics.
